adhesion |
process of water molecules sticking to other substances |
|
cohesion |
water molecules attract each other because charges |
|
density |
measurement of how much mass is contained in a given volume of an object |
|
capillary action |
combined force of attraction among water molecules and with the molecules of surrounding materials |
|
specific heat |
amount of heat needed to increase the temperature of a certain mass of a substance by 1 C |
|
phase |
state in which matter can exist |
|
polar molecule |
molecule that has electrically charged areas |
|
solute |
substance that is dissolved (ex. sugar) |
|
solution |
mixture that forms when one substance dissolves another |
|
solvent |
substance that does the dissolving (ex. Water) |
|
weathering |
process that breaks down rock and other substances at earths surface |
|
physical weathering |
type of weathering in which rock is physically broken into smaller pieces ( freezing, thawing, pressure, growth of plants, animals, and abrasion |
|
chemical weathering |
process that breaks down rock through chemical change (water, oxygen, carbon dioxide, organisms, acid rain) |
|
surface tension |
the tightness across the surface of water that is caused by the polar molecules pulling on each other |
|
ground water |
water that fills the cracks and spaces in underground soil and rock layers |
